ISEQ slips in mid-morning trading
The ISEQ slipped 2.9 points to 6,220.89 in morning trading today, with building group Kingspan leading the list of risers.
The Co Cavan building materials group has seen shares surge 24c to €8.80 today after today revealing pre-tax profits climbed 34% in 2004 to €88m.
Financial shares have not fared so well, however. While Allied Irish Bank shares are unchanged at €16.14, Bank of Ireland shares have slipped 2c to €13.05 while Anglo Irish Bank shares have slipped 5c to €20.35.
Irish Life & Permanent, which yesterday revealed a 57% profits surge to €411.2m, slipped back on some of the gains of yesterday, falling 16c to €14.64.
Pharmaceutical company Elan - which suffered such a tough time as shares collapsed last week - has climbed 15c to €5.15 today.
Paddy Power shares have also surged today, climbing 20c to €13.95.
The most traded shares today are Anglo Irish Bank, Ryanair, Fyffes, Irish Life & Permanent and CRH.
